Object Description
NAVY BLUE JACKET - 6 FRONT BUTTONS BRASS- METALLIC TRIM (GOLD) ON SLEEVES- 1 GOLD STAR ON EACH SLEEVE.
Origin
The left breast pocket of the jacket contains the Admiral's service ribbons and a device pin. The ribbons, from the top left side, are a Defense Distinguished Service Medal, Navy Distinguished Service Medal , Legion of Merit with four Gold Stars, Meritorious Service Medal with one Gold Star, Commendation Medal with Combat "V" and one Gold Star, Achievement Medal, Combat Action Ribbon, Meritorious Unit Commendation Ribbon, Navy E Ribbon, National Defense Service Ribbon, Armed Forces Expeditionary Medal Ribbon, Vietnam (RVN) Service Medal Ribbon, Navy Sea Service Deployment Ribbon with one Bronze Star, Republic of Vietnam (RVN) Campaign Medal Ribbon, and Navy Expert Pistol Medal Ribbon. The gold pin above the ribbons is the Surface Warfare Officer Pin.
Vice Admiral Michael P. Kalleres has a long and extensive resume. In summation, he is graduate of Purdue & George Washington Universities, Kalleres served for 32 years in the US Navy. He was former Atlantic Naval forces Fleet Commander during Desert Storm. During his tenure as Commander, US Second Fleet in the Atlantic/NATO Striking Fleet, he commanded over 250,000 Navy, Marine, fleet forces of 10 countries, 300 to 400 ships, and over 2000 aircraft. After retirement, Kalleres participated in many charities, was seated on several boards, and served as a senior advisor for Disaster Relief and Officer Development on the National Advisory Board of the Salvation Army. He has also been a military and international security on-screen consultant/analyst for local NBC and ABC TV affiliates. During his naval career, Kalleres received 18 military awards and decorations including the Defense Distinguished Service Medal.
